Output 659701dc72bf62402b972fd18178041df3243eae9e61aca737e0afd9667b2b19:0

value
1833006
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f6aff401394839175d51588d345f75a46f1d378 OP_EQUAL
address
37ULfv5SHjjFBXjNU4MXMQ1RRChBAJzHYh
transaction
659701dc72bf62402b972fd18178041df3243eae9e61aca737e0afd9667b2b19
spent
true